How I Can Help

I am a somatic therapist who focuses on relational, attachment, and childhood trauma issues. I work with individuals and couples to address relationship ambivalence, codependence, anxiety, depression, major life transition, PTSD and trauma, shame and low self-esteem, and poor communication and conflict, among other issues. I help you build awareness of your thoughts, feelings, and physical sensations, allowing you to develop greater insight and uncover new choices.

About Me

I utilize trauma and attachment theories frequently as a way to frame issues. Working somatically, I highlight and promote the body-mind connection and reference our therapeutic relationship as a source of information and insight.

My work is also influenced and informed by:

Dance. As a lifelong dancer, I see the body as a source of information and healing. Through somatic therapy, we build physical and psychological strength to transform what holds us back into what moves us forward.

Nature. As a vision quest guide, I lead people into nature to reestablish contact with their natural rhythms and with parts of themselves lost in the din of daily life. We access your inner state of nature to help you regain purpose and find your path to healing.

Relationship. Our organisms are built to continuously attune to one another. Together we create a new space in which you can experience yourself in a different way.

My Approach

My style is warm and direct. I am nurturing and supportive, yet I also call it as I see it. I foster the development of safety and trust in our relationship so that together we can explore and process what may be inaccessible or overwhelming to do alone.

More About My Practice

Traumatic experiences change us physically, mentally, and emotionally. Nowhere else is the wound so deep and nowhere else can healing be as profound and transformative. I support you in safely processing traumatic events to uncover new states of freedom and aliveness. We look to the body to identify your strengths, your edges, and your unique path to healing. Whether you have experienced a singular terrifying event or endured cumulative incidences of fear, violence, and neglect, you can heal.

Relationships bring out the best and worst in us. Navigating the space between love and heartbreak can reopen our earliest traumas. Sometimes our partners become strangers to us. Sometimes we become strangers to ourselves. I work with gay and straight, monogamous and polyamorous couples on a variety of issues, including conflict, communication, ambivalence in relationships, infidelity, and breaches of trust. I utilize somatic therapy to help individuals find safety, emotional connection, intimacy, and passion in their relationships.
